What moves the price
- Tapping an existing circuit vs pulling a new dedicated circuit
- GFCI and AFCI upgrades to current code
- Finished-wall fishing vs open access
- Outdoor weather-rated in-use covers vs interior receptacles
- Number of devices done in a single visit

What is the difference between a new outlet and a new circuit?
Adding an outlet on an existing circuit is the cheaper option, we're just extending a line that's already there. A new dedicated circuit means running fresh wire back to the panel, which costs more but is required for things like a microwave or workshop tool.

Do you install standby generators in Poway?
Yes. Standby generator install is regular scope in Poway given fire-risk exposure in the eastern hills around Sycamore Canyon and the recurring PSPS events that affect the area. Typical install (14-30kW Generac, Kohler, or Briggs & Stratton with propane or natural gas fuel infrastructure, automatic transfer switch, and concrete pad) runs $11,000-$24,000 depending on generator size and critical-load scope.
